Gluten free

Italian Lemon Almond and White Chocolate Cake is gluten free. Made with almond flour (almond meal) it’s a wonderfully moist cake, with a slightly dense crumb.

Almond topping

We have adapted this Italian lemon, almond and white chocolate cake to add a crunchy, thin almond praline topping that adds a light crunch along with the moist cake. You can absolutely leave the almond topping from the recipe and still have a delicious dessert. Delicious Italian Lemon Almond And White Chocolate Cake - Recipe Winners (3)

Freezing

Italian Lemon Almond and White Chocolate Cake will keep in the fridge for 4-5 days after baking and freezes very well for several months. We do not recommend freezing the cake if you have added the almond praline topping.

Yield: 12 serves

Italian Lemon Almond and White Chocolate Cake

Prep Time: 30 minutes

Cook Time: 40 minutes

Total Time: 1 hour 10 minutes

This moist, lemony Italian lemon cake has the option of having a toffee almond topping. Delicious with, or without the topping.

Ingredients

Cake

  • 350g almond flour (almond meal) -12 ounces
  • 200g white chocolate chopped (7 ounces) - we used 2 blocks Lindt extra silky white chocolate
  • 2 tablespoons full cream milk or cream
  • 180g butter softened (6 ounces)
  • 130g castor sugar (4 1/2 ounces)
  • 3 tablespoons lemon zest
  • 4 large eggs, separated
  • 1 teaspoon lemon extract -optional
  • 2 tablespoons lemon juice
  • 100g slivered almonds (3 1/2 ounces)

Almond Praline Topping

  • 45 gm slicedalmonds
  • 90 gm butter (3 1/4 ounces)
  • 7 1/2 tablespoons castor sugar
  • 1 1/2 tablespoons milk
  • 1 1/2 tablespoons plain flour (all-purpose flour)or gluten free plain flour

Instructions

Cake

  • preheat oven to 350 f (175c)
  • grease and line base 10 1/2 inch or 27cm of springform pan with baking paper
  • combine chocolate and milk and gently melt over double boiler or microwave till melted
  • set chocolate aside to cool
  • beat butter with sugar till light, white and fluffy (around 3 minutes)
  • add lemon zest, egg yolks, and extract if using till well combined
  • now add almond flour (almond meal), melted chocolate and lemon juice
  • beat until combined
  • add slivered almonds
  • in a separate bowl beat egg whites till soft peak
  • fold egg whites through mixture gently till combined
  • spoon batter into cake tin and smooth top
  • bake for 40-45 minutes or until golden and skewer comes out clean
  • remove cake from oven
  • turn oven up to 400 f (200 c)
  • spread almond topping evenly over cake
  • return cake to oven for 5 minutes
  • keep an eye on the almonds as you only want them to go golden ( 4-5 minutes)
  • remove cake from oven
  • run a knife around sides of cake tin
  • allow to cool completely in the tin
  • release sides of tin
  • slide cake onto a serving plate
  • serve and enjoy!

Almond topping

  • mix all topping ingredients together in a small saucepan over medium heat
  • stir constantly with a flat spoon or spatular as the mixture catches easily
  • allow the mixture to boil and bubble for a minute until the sugar has dissolved
  • pour over the cake while still hot
  • spread over top of cooked cake until you have an even layer then return to the cake to the oven until golden (5 minutes)

Notes

  • cake freezes well
  • almond topping is optional

What is Elvis Presley cake? ›

An Elvis Presley cake is a single-layer classic yellow cake that's topped with a pineapple glaze. Much like a poke cake, the syrup and juices of the pineapple will seep into the cake through fork holes, resulting in a decadent, ultra-moist cake.
